Pattern Select Switch EV Mode Circuit [08/2023 - ]: Procedure

WARNING: This page is about a different car, the 2025 Lexus RX 450h+ and 2024 Lexus RX 450h+. However, it is still accessible from the selected car via links, so may be relevant.
  1. ASK ABOUT VEHICLE CONDITION 
    1. Check if a buzzer sounded and a message was displayed on the multi-information display when attempting to enter EV mode.

      Result

      Result Proceed to
      No buzzer sounded and no message was displayed on multi-information display. A
      A buzzer sounded and a message was displayed on multi-information display. B

      HINT: 

      If a buzzer sounds or a message is displayed on the multi-information display, one or more of the EV mode entry conditions have not been met. Check that all of the EV mode entry conditions have been met before pressing the EV mode switch.

  6. CHECK HARNESS AND CONNECTOR (AUTO EV/HV MODE SWITCH - BODY GROUND) 
    1. Disconnect the AUTO EV/HV mode switch connector.
    2.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      C29-7 (E) - Body ground Always Below 1 Ω
    3. Reconnect the AUTO EV/HV mode switch connector.

  7. CHECK HARNESS AND CONNECTOR (HYBRID VEHICLE CONTROL ECU - AUTO EV/HV MODE SWITCH (ELECTRIC PARKING BRAKE SWITCH ASSEMBLY)) 
    1. Disconnect the hybrid vehicle control ECU connector.
    2. Disconnect the AUTO EV/HV mode switch connector.
    3.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      C59-42 (EVMS) - C29-13 (B) Always Below 1 Ω
      C59-42 (EVMS) or C29-13 (B) - Body ground Always 10 kΩ or higher
    4. Reconnect the AUTO EV/HV mode switch connector.
    5. Reconnect the hybrid vehicle control ECU connector.
